Angie Hewes is a dedicated business education teacher at Smyrna High School in Delaware, where she has been teaching for 23 years. She is known for her commitment to career and technical education (CTE) and for going above and beyond to support her students both inside and outside the classroom.

Hewes introduced the Academy of Finance program at Smyrna High School, a three-course CTE program that covers topics such as banking, credit, financial planning, accounting, and insurance. While classroom instruction is important, Hewes believes that real-world experiences are essential for students to truly grasp financial concepts.

To provide her students with hands-on learning opportunities, Hewes worked to secure an Innovation Grant from the state. This grant allowed the school to purchase a mobile school store that can be moved to different parts of the campus. This innovative approach enables students to gain experience as sales and marketing interns, even if they are unable to access internships in the local community due to transportation limitations.

Seyyed Latif Sharifi is a high school teacher, but he goes above and beyond his job description. He helps his students complete college applications, fill out financial aid forms, and update their resumes—often on his own time. But Sharifi’s true passion lies in advocating for his students’ success, and he has found innovative ways to support them.

One day, Sharifi had a chance encounter with his cousin’s virtual reality headset, which sparked an idea. He realized that virtual reality could be a tool to provide his students with experiences they may never have had the opportunity to enjoy. “Virtual reality could be the link I’d need for my students to enjoy experiences that some have never participated in,” he said.

Through virtual reality, Sharifi has exposed his students to experiences like mountain biking, concerts, and international travel. While it hasn’t been without challenges, as some students may have sensitivities to external stimuli, Sharifi has worked to slowly integrate virtual reality into his lessons. He shared, “For the most part, they’ve bought in, and to hear them audibly squeal with joy during a lesson is what a teacher like me lives for.”

Sharifi’s innovative approach extends beyond virtual reality. He created “Sharifi’s Bistro” as a hands-on learning opportunity for his students. Twice a week, they serve cookies, hot chocolate, and coffee to the school’s students and staff. The students shop for ingredients, help prepare the food, and work the cash register. “They do it with smiles on their faces,” Sharifi noted. “The skills they learn have the potential to follow them into the workforce if that’s where they decide to venture.”

Lions are social animals that live in groups called prides. These prides are typically made up of several related females, their offspring, and a few adult males. The females are the primary hunters of the group, using their speed and agility to take down prey such as zebras, antelope, and wildebeest. The males protect the pride and its territory from rival lions and other threats.

One of the most striking features of lions is their roar, which can be heard from several miles away. This powerful vocalization is used to communicate with other members of the pride, as well as to warn off intruders and attract potential mates. The roar of a lion is a truly awe-inspiring sound that sends chills down the spine of anyone lucky enough to hear it in person.

Unfortunately, lions are facing numerous threats in the wild, including habitat loss, poaching, and conflict with humans. As a result, their populations are dwindling, and they are now classified as a vulnerable species by the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N).
